
Living in New York City, where space is at a premium and energy costs can be high, finding energy-efficient lighting solutions is crucial for both the environment and your wallet. Here are some top strategies and products to help you illuminate your apartment efficiently without sacrificing style or comfort.
1. LED Bulbs
Benefits
- Energy Savings: LED bulbs use up to 75% less energy than traditional incandescent bulbs.
- Long Lifespan: LEDs can last up to 25,000 hours, reducing the frequency of replacements.
- Lower Heat Emission: They emit less heat, making them safer and more comfortable, especially in small spaces.
Recommendations
- Warm White LED Bulbs: Ideal for living areas and bedrooms, providing a cozy and inviting atmosphere.
- Daylight LED Bulbs: Best for kitchens and bathrooms, offering bright and clear illumination.
2. Smart Lighting Systems
Benefits
- Remote Control: Use your smartphone or voice commands to control your lighting from anywhere.
- Energy Monitoring: Track energy usage and adjust settings to save power.
- Customization: Create schedules and scenes to optimize lighting based on your daily routines.
Recommendations
- Philips Hue: Offers a wide range of smart bulbs and accessories, compatible with most smart home systems.
- LIFX: Known for their bright, colorful bulbs that don’t require a hub, making them easy to install and use.
3. Dimmers and Motion Sensors
Benefits
- Dimming: Adjust light levels to suit different activities and moods, reducing energy consumption.
- Motion Sensors: Automatically turn lights on and off, ensuring lights are only used when needed.
Recommendations
- Lutron Caseta: A reliable brand for dimmers and smart switches, offering easy installation and integration with smart home systems.
- Ecolink Motion Sensor: Works with most smart home hubs and provides reliable motion detection for automated lighting control.
4. Natural Light Utilization
Benefits
- Energy-Free: Utilizing natural light reduces the need for artificial lighting during the day.
- Health Benefits: Natural light can improve mood and productivity while reducing eye strain.
Strategies
- Mirrors: Strategically place mirrors to reflect natural light and brighten up your space.
- Sheer Curtains: Use light, sheer curtains to allow maximum daylight while maintaining privacy.
- Light Colors: Opt for light-colored walls and furnishings to enhance the natural light in your apartment.
5. Energy Star Certified Fixtures
Benefits
- Energy Efficiency: Fixtures with the Energy Star label meet strict energy efficiency guidelines set by the U.S. Environmental Protection Agency.
- Quality: These fixtures often provide better performance and longevity.
Recommendations
- Energy Star LED Fixtures: Available in various styles, from ceiling lights to wall sconces, ensuring you can find energy-efficient options to suit any room.
- Under-Cabinet Lighting: Energy Star LED under-cabinet lights are perfect for kitchens, providing efficient task lighting without consuming much power.
6. Task Lighting
Benefits
- Focused Illumination: Provides bright, focused light for specific tasks, reducing the need to light up entire rooms.
- Versatility: Easily movable and adjustable to suit different needs and spaces.
Recommendations
- LED Desk Lamps: Ideal for workspaces and reading nooks, offering adjustable brightness and direction.
- Clip-On Lamps: Perfect for adding light to specific areas without the need for permanent fixtures.
